pub enum RegistrationResult {
Created,
AlreadyKnown,
}Expand description
Outcome of a PathRegistry::register call.
Variants§
Created
Path was newly created — caller should issue a challenge.
AlreadyKnown
Path was already present. No state change.
Trait Implementations§
Source§impl Clone for RegistrationResult
impl Clone for RegistrationResult
Source§fn clone(&self) -> RegistrationResult
fn clone(&self) -> RegistrationResult
Returns a duplicate of the value. Read more
1.0.0 (const: unstable) ·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reimpl Copy for RegistrationResult
Source§impl Debug for RegistrationResult
impl Debug for RegistrationResult
impl Eq for RegistrationResult
Source§impl PartialEq for RegistrationResult
impl PartialEq for RegistrationResult
Source§fn eq(&self, other: &RegistrationResult) -> bool
fn eq(&self, other: &RegistrationResult) -> bool
Tests for
self and other values to be equal, and is used by ==.impl StructuralPartialEq for RegistrationResult
Auto Trait Implementations§
impl Freeze for RegistrationResult
impl RefUnwindSafe for RegistrationResult
impl Send for RegistrationResult
impl Sync for RegistrationResult
impl Unpin for RegistrationResult
impl UnsafeUnpin for RegistrationResult
impl UnwindSafe for RegistrationResult
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more